The size of Gleniffer is approximately 63.1 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 49.1% of total area. The population of Gleniffer in 2016 was 369 people. By 2021 the population was 414 showing a population growth of 12.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gleniffer is 50-59 years. Households in Gleniffer are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gleniffer work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 81.90% of the homes in Gleniffer were owner-occupied compared with 71.70% in 2016.
